If you own an Esonic H61 motherboard and are facing the dreaded “No Internet access” or “Ethernet controller has no driver” error in Windows, you are not alone. The Esonic H61 is a budget-friendly, legacy board (based on Intel’s H61 chipset). While it runs older CPUs like the Intel Core i3/i5 2nd and 3rd Gen well, finding official drivers can feel like a scavenger hunt.

Since Esonic provides no official driver downloads, the following prioritized sources are recommended:
| Priority | Source | Method | Reliability | |----------|--------|--------|--------------| | 1 | Realtek Official Website | Direct download for RTL8111/8168 | High | | 2 | Driver packs (Snappy Driver Installer) | Offline, open-source | Medium-High | | 3 | OEM drivers (e.g., Gigabyte/ASUS H61) | Extract from similar H61 boards | Medium (tested) | | 4 | Third-party driver updaters (e.g., DriverPack) | Automated installation | Low (adware risk) |
The CD that came with Esonic H61 is often outdated and may cause blue screens on newer Windows versions. Do not use it. Always get the driver from Realtek. Download Snappy Driver Installer Origin (SDIO) on another
Unlike ASUS or Gigabyte, Esonic does not maintain a robust driver archive. This means you cannot simply type in a serial number and download the setup file. Most Esonic H61 boards use one of three specific LAN chips.
To fix the issue, you must identify which chip is on your board.
